UNIT #4757

Since the beginning of 2005 the members of FIST realized that sooner or later something would have to be done with our current Mobile Investigation Unit. We were constantly having to add brake fluid and we began to see oil on the floor in the area normally associated with a failure of the rear main bearing. And then, history repeated itself again.

In mid-May the team became aware that a former type III ambulance owned by Union Fire-Rescue was about to become surplus. Inquiries were made into what was going to happen to the vehicle, and within a week, an agreement had been reached for the team to purchase the vehicle for $500.00. The truck was transfered to FIST on May 22, and almost immediately the conversion work began. And on the evening of June 3 the new vehicle responded on it's maiden voyage when the team was activated to a structure fire in Lake of the Four Seasons.

The new vehicle has sufficient exterior storage space to carry all the team's current equipment and supplies and still have plenty of room left over. The rear section of the vehicle was completely refurbished to allow witness interviews or team planning sessions in comfort and away from the elements.
